Kickmetry is an AI football insights platform. It reads match data the way an analyst would and explains it in a few clear sentences, so you understand why a match unfolded the way it did.
The private beta opens in Q3 2026 for waitlist members, with a public launch following once the predictive models are fully validated.
We start with the Premier League, then expand to La Liga, Serie A, Bundesliga and Ligue 1, followed by major European competitions.
Yes — a free tier will always include match summaries and core statistics. Deeper predictive tooling and player intelligence will sit in a paid plan.
